Description Weldon Matt 2009-08-01 13:28:11 UTC
Last night I took my Baby to my girlfriend's house, did a factory reset, connected it to her network and listened to content from SN (no SC connection).

Today I brought it home, plugged it in, and tried connecting to Internet Radio for the heck of it (knowing it wouldn't work).

First I got a "connecting to mysqueezebox.com" spinny (would be nicer if I first got a "connecting to [network x]" spinny, where [network x] was the last network I was connected to).  Then, after the inevitable failure, I got a "Can't Connect to Library" message.  

This "Can't Connect to Library" message is intended solely for the case where a network connection exists but we can't connect to SC.  So the messaging here with this error was completely wrong (I'm being asked to go to my computer and check Squeezebox Server etc).

What SHOULD happen here is a wireless network error (my previous connection was to a wireless network), instructing me to choose a different network etc.
